Understanding PCP Claims: A Comprehensive Guide
PCP claims, or Personal Contract Purchase, are a popular financing option for vehicle purchases in the UK. They offer a flexible way to spread the cost of your car over a set period, with regular monthly payments and the option to change or return the vehicle at the end of the agreement. Understanding how PCP claims work is crucial when considering this type of finance. This comprehensive guide will break down the key aspects, including the benefits, process, and potential pitfalls, ensuring you’re fully informed before making a decision.
When it comes to PCP claims in the UK, the process involves several steps. Initially, you’ll choose a vehicle within the agreed budget and term length. Then, monthly payments are made based on the remaining value of the car, known as the balloon payment, which is due at the end of the agreement. If you decide to change or return the vehicle, you can do so with minimal hassle, provided you meet certain conditions. However, it’s essential to be aware of potential charges and how they might impact your overall cost.

Maximizing Your Compensation: Tips for PCP Claims
When making a PCP (Personal Contract Purchase) claim in the UK, understanding how to maximise your compensation is essential. Firstly, gather all relevant documents and evidence related to your purchase and any subsequent issues. This includes contracts, maintenance records, and any communication with the dealer or manufacturer. Organising these will help strengthen your case and provide clear insight into the agreement terms.
Additionally, familiarise yourself with your consumer rights under UK law. The Consumer Rights Act 2015 offers protections for PCP agreements, ensuring you receive a vehicle of acceptable quality. If you encounter significant issues, such as major defects or persistent mechanical problems, these can be grounds for a claim. Documenting the problems and their impact on your driving experience will strengthen your argument for compensation or a solution under your PCP agreement.
